Own-sourced copper production from Glencore’s African copper assets — KCC and Mutanda — rose by 27,400 tonnes (68%) year on year to 67,900 tonnes, with KCC contributing 51,900 tonnes (up 72% year on year) and Mutanda 16,000 tonnes (up 55%), according to the production report. Glencore attributed the increase to improved grades at both operations.
African cobalt production fell to 5,100 tonnes, down by 42% year on year, with Mutanda producing no cobalt in the quarter compared with 2,900 tonnes a year earlier, according to the report.
For the first quarter of 2026, Glencore’s own-sourced cobalt production was 5,800 tonnes, down by 39% year on year.
